hayes1966 wrote:Is there a designated practise night at the range?
No, but you can use the range any time as long as the Concordia is open and you have someone 18 or older with you for safety. That person does not have to shoot they just need to be there so you are not alone. (I think it is mainly to avoid the cleanup if you die down there for some reason. :lol:)
The Concordia is usually open after 3pm 7 days a week.

You should get your access card in the next week or 2 since you, John B and Mike will be voted in tomorrow.

On league nights you can come down early to practice before a match if that works for you.

Some members get together for practice on nights that are convenient to them. Ask around you may find a group that comes to the range on a regular basis.
